Essential Terms to Know in Bus Accident Cases

Familiarity with common legal terms can help you understand the bus accident claim process. Below are some important definitions related to bus accident cases and personal injury law in California.

Liability

Liability refers to the legal responsibility one party has for causing harm or damages to another. In bus accident cases, liability determines who is at fault and who must compensate the injured party.

Damages

Damages are the monetary compensation sought for losses resulting from an accident. This includes medical expenses, lost income, pain and suffering, and property damage.

Negligence

Negligence occurs when a party fails to exercise reasonable care, leading to injury or damage. Proving negligence is often essential to winning a bus accident claim.

Settlement

A settlement is an agreement between parties to resolve a claim without going to trial. Settlements often involve compensation paid by the liable party to the injured individual.

Tips for Handling Bus Accident Cases Effectively

Document Everything Thoroughly

After a bus accident, carefully document all details including photos of the scene, contact information of witnesses, and medical reports. This information supports your claim and helps your legal team build a strong case.

Seek Medical Attention Promptly

Even if injuries seem minor, it is important to get medical evaluation immediately. Some injuries may not be apparent right away but require treatment and documentation for your claim.

Frequently Asked Questions About Bus Accident Cases

What should I do immediately after a bus accident?

Immediately after a bus accident, ensure your safety and seek medical attention even if injuries seem minor. Document the accident scene and gather contact information from witnesses. Reporting the accident to authorities is also important. Prompt action helps protect your health and preserves important evidence for your claim.

In California,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ims, including bus accidents, is generally two years from the date of the accident. It is important to consult with a law firm promptly to ensure your claim is filed within this timeframe and to avoid losing your legal rights.

Liability in bus accidents can rest with the bus driver, the bus company, maintenance providers, or other third parties depending on the circumstances. Identifying the liable parties requires thorough investigation to hold the responsible individuals or entities accountable.

Insurance coverage varies based on the parties involved. Bus companies often carry liability insurance, but coverage limits and claim procedures differ. Personal injury law firms help navigate insurance claims to maximize compensation for your injuries and losses.

Compensation amounts depend on factors like the severity of injuries, med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ering. A thorough evaluation by legal professionals helps estimate potential compensation based on your unique circumstances.

Claims involving government entities may have special rules and shorter deadlines. Consulting a knowledgeable personal injury law firm ensures these requirements are met and your claim is properly pursued.

California follows a comparative fault system, allowing injured parties to recover damages even if partially at fault. Compensation may be reduced based on your percentage of fault, but legal representation helps ensure fair consideration.

The duration of bus accident cases varies widely depending on case complexity, cooperation from parties, and court schedules. Some cases settle within months, while others may take years. Your legal team will provide guidance tailored to your case.
